Correction: Gene Regulatory Network Analysis Identifies Sex-Linked Differences in Colon Cancer Drug Metabolism

Camila M Lopes-Ramos, Marieke L Kuijjer, Shuji Ogino, Charles S Fuchs, Dawn L DeMeo, Kimberly Glass, John Quackenbush
PMCID: PMC10348691  NIHMSID: NIHMS1885190  PMID: 30987980

In the original version of this article (1), in the Disclosure of Potential Conflicts of Interest section, Dr. Charles S. Fuchs did not report consulting work with the biotechnology and pharmaceutical industry focused on cancer drug development. With respect to an analysis of molecular features that drive sex differences in colorectal cancer development, Dr. Fuchs did not consider that his consulting work in drug development represented a potential conflict of interest or a relevant financial activity to the submitted work. But in the interest of full transparency, Dr. Fuchs has requested that his disclosures be added to the publication. This section has been updated in the latest online HTML and PDF versions of the article.
